PharmD Graduate Tuition and Fees — 2025-2026
See below for access to detailed information regarding Purdue tuition, rates and fees for graduate students, including summer, fall/spring and winter rate information as well as other case-specific fees that may not be included with the seasonal fee information.
Pharmacy (Pharm D) P1 – P3 – Flat Rate (8+ credit hours)
General Service | $ 4,859.00 | $ 9,718.00 |
Student Fitness and Wellness Fee3 | $ 117.00 | $ 234.00 |
Student Activity Fee3 | $ 20.00 | $ 40.00 |
Differential General Service6 | $ 6,640.00 | $ 13,280.00 |
Sub-Total Tuition: | $ 11,636.00 | $ 23,272.00 |
Other Estimated Expenses (not billed through Bursar)
Housing/Food* | $ 6,860.00 | $ 13,720.00 |
Books/Course Materials/Supplies/Equipment** | $ 280.00 | $ 560.00 |
Transportation*** | $ 95.00 | $ 190.00 |
Miscellaneous/Federal Student Loan Fees**** | $ 1,275.00 | $ 2,550.00 |
Sub-Total Est Expenses: | $ 8,510.00 | $ 17,020.00 |
Total Tuition, Housing & Misc Exp | $ 20,146.00 | $ 40,292.00 |
**Books are average over fall and spring semesters.
***Transportation cost for off-campus students is $550 per semester. Students that fly to their homes will have higher estimated transportation costs.
****Costs vary. Loan fees apply if the student is receiving federal loans of any kind.
